>t RANCHO SECO UNIT 1 T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S Surveillance Standards 4.8 AUXILIARY FEEDWATER PUMP PERIODIC TESTING Applicability Applies to the periodic testing of the turbine and motor driven auxiliary feedwater pumps.

Obj ective To verify that the auxiliary feedwater pump and associated valves are operable.

Specification 4.8.1 System Tests 148><

A.

At least once per 18 months:

1.

Verify that each automatic valve in the flow path actuates to its correct position upon receipt of each auxiliary feedwater actuation test signal.

2.

Verify that each auxiliary feedwater pump starts as designed automatically upon receipt of each auxiliary feedwater actuation test signal.

B.

The test will be considered satisfactory if visual observation and control board indication verifies that all components have responded to the actuation signal and the appropriate pump breakers shall have opened or closed, and all power actuated valves shall have completed their travel.

C.

Prior to startup following a refueling shutdown or any cold shutdown of longer than 30 days duration, conduct a test to demonstrate that the motor-driven AFW pumps can pump water from the CST to the steam generator, l

D.

All valves including those that are locked, sealed, or utnerwise secured in position, are to be inspected monthly to verify they are in the proper position.
